随着互联网技术的发展和普及,APP应用已经成为人们生活中不可缺少的一部分。而其中的软件研发者也逐渐成为了互联网行业中的中坚力量。盐湖APP软件研发团队作为资深的开发者之一,在长期的软件开发过程中积累了许多宝贵的经验。本文将分享他们的成功经验,包括项目策划、需求分析、技术选型、开发实践和软件测试五个阶段,希望能为广大研发者提供借鉴和参考。
1. 项目策划:细节决定成败
一个项目的成功,从一开始的项目策划就非常重要。在策划阶段中,需要团队成员对项目的目标、定位、流程、功能、人员等各个方面做出详细、全面的分析和规划。特别是对软件的功能模块,一定要考虑到用户体验。软件功能的设计要多考虑用户真实需求,做到简单明了、易用易上手。细节往往能决定软件的成功或失败。关注用户使用中的需求和反馈,不断提升软件的用户体验,能够让软件站稳市场。
2. 需求分析:入情入理,跟用户心灵沟通
需求分析是软件研发中极其重要的一个环节。需要大量的交互和访谈,将产品的功能需求和用户的真实需求相结合。通过和用户的沟通,了解用户的想法和反馈,挖掘出用户的真实需求和痛点,才能确定软件的开发方向。在需求分析中,团队成员要入情入理,充分理解用户需求,根据具体情况提出恰当的方案和建议,跟用户心灵沟通,确保软件的研发贴近市场。
3. 技术选型:依据业务特点,选择最合适的技术
技术选型是决定软件质量和速度的关键。在技术选型中,需要针对业务特点确定所需技术,常用的技术有Java、Python、C#等等。除了技术本身的优缺点,还需要根据具体需求考虑技术的稳定性、易用性、安全性等问题。同时,要注意技术的更新速度以及开发团队掌握程度。在选型中,团队成员需充分沟通,选择最合适的技术路径,才能确保软件的高质量、高效率和安全性。
4. 开发实践:代码质量重要性不容忽视
开发实践是软件开发的核心环节。在实践中,需要严格执行代码规范,保证代码质量。代码编写时需要确保每一行代码都能正常运行、易于理解和修改,同时也要注重其可扩展性。在代码实践中常用的设计模式和框架有MVC、MVVM、DDD等等,在具体实践中需要结合业务的特点和团队成员的实际情况选择合适的实践方式。同时,要注意开发进度和开发质量的协调,保持稳步发展。
5. 软件测试:全方位测试,确保稳定运行
软件测试是确保软件质量的重要步骤。在测试过程中,需要对各类功能模块、用户体验、安装流程、兼容性等方面进行全方位测试。对于不同的测试环节,测试人员需要结合用户使用习惯、实际需求等制定相应的测试方案和测试用例。同时,针对测试结果的反馈,开发人员要快速定位并修复问题,确保软件能稳定运行,用户满意度达到最高。
盐湖APP软件是一个拥有多年历史的APP软件,经过多年的发展,已经成为了一款用户体验极佳,功能完善的APP软件。而这个成功的背后,离不开资深研发人员的努力。本文将会分享盐湖APP软件资深研发人员们成功的经验,从而能够帮助更多的开发人员在自己的工作中获得成功。
1. 学习最新技术,保持开放心态
作为APP软件研发人员,学习最新的技术和方法是非常重要的一点。因此,资深研发人员们总是会保持开放的心态,积极地参加各种技术交流会和培训课程,以便更好地了解行业最新发展趋势,顺应潮流,跟上时代的步伐。
2. 立足用户需求,保证设计用户友好
用户需求是设计APP软件的出发点,因此,盐湖APP软件资深研发人员们总是会以用户需求为核心,结合用户使用习惯,深入研究用户行为,从而设计出更加优秀的用户体验。用户友好的设计,能够给用户带来更加愉悦的使用体验,从而提升用户的满意度。
3. 细节把握,注重品质
细节是决定品质的一些关键点之一,这也是盐湖APP软件在研发过程中非常注重的一个方面。尽管一些细节可能看起来非常小,但是所有的这些细节的累积,能够最终决定一个产品的质量与否。因此,在盐湖APP软件的研发过程中,资深研发人员总是会对细节进行高度把握,从而确保产品的品质。
4. 成体系化运营,配合市场需求
APP软件的成功并不只是软件本身的问题,更多的是需要软件运营得当。因此,资深研发人员在成功经验中强调,需要对软件进行成体系化的运营布局,充分配合市场需求,深入了解并掌握用户心理,努力提高转化率。
5. 团队合作,高度信任与配合
一个优秀的APP软件研发团队,是由众多优秀的研发人员组成的。因此,资深研发人员们强调,在团队中需要保持高度的信任和配合,相互支持,同时高效地沟通。这样才能够在软件研发方面获得更加持久的成功。
以上是盐湖APP软件资深研发人员们成功的经验分享,希望所有的开发人员都能够从中获得启示,更加努力地投入到自己的工作中,不断进步,创造更多的成就。